Description

Muscowpetung Education Centre (MEC) is dedicated to providing a holistic and culturally enriched learning environment for our youth. We are looking for energetic and reliable Substitute Teachers to join our team on a casual basis. As a substitute at MEC, you are more than just a placeholder; you are a vital part of our students' day, ensuring that their education remains consistent and that our classrooms remain a safe, respectful place to learn.

Key Responsibilities

-Classroom Instruction: Deliver pre-planned lessons with enthusiasm and clarity across various grade levels (K-12).
-Student Engagement: Foster a positive learning atmosphere that encourages student participation and respects individual learning styles.
-Cultural Sensitivity: Uphold and integrate the values and traditions of the Muscowpetung Saulteaux Nation within the classroom.
-Safety & Supervision: Manage classroom behaviour in accordance with MEC policies and perform necessary supervision during breaks, lunch, and bus transitions.
-Professionalism: Maintain confidentiality regarding student information and provide clear feedback to the regular classroom teacher upon their return.

Qualifications

-Teaching Credentials: A valid Saskatchewan Professional Teaching Certificate is highly preferred.
Educational Background: Individuals with a degree in Education or a related field who are eligible for a Temporary Teaching Permit will also be considered.
-Experience: Previous experience teaching or working with Indigenous youth is a significant asset.
-Adaptability: The ability to walk into a new classroom environment and build immediate rapport with students and staff.

Mandatory Requirements

-Clearances: A current Criminal Record Check with Vulnerable Sector Check (must be provided prior to the first day of work).
-Communication: Must have a reliable way to be contacted for early-morning "call-outs."
